Eric Adams is a public servant, technology advocate, business executive, and innovator whose career spans more than four decades in law enforcement, government, public policy, economic development, and emerging technologies.
Adams served as the 110th Mayor of New York City, the 18th Borough President of Brooklyn, and a New York State Senator representing Central Brooklyn. Prior to public office, he served more than 22 years in the New York City Police Department, retiring at the rank of Captain.
How the four pillars map to real outcomes, priority sectors, and strategic alignment for the counterparties we serve.
| Pillar | Outcome | Priority Sectors | Strategic Alignment |
|---|---|---|---|
| GPOD Green Electricity | Reliable, clean baseload & distributed power | Utilities · Data centers · Islands & remote grids | Energy independence · Grid resilience · Decarbonization |
| Beyond Water (AWG) | Potable water independent of aquifers & pipelines | Municipal water · Humanitarian response · Agriculture | Water security · Climate adaptation · Public health |
| Non-Corrosive Rebar | Long-service-life structures in coastal & storm zones | Bridges & ports · Coastal housing · Critical infrastructure | Infrastructure modernization · Disaster resilience |
| Fast Modular Housing | Dignified, storm-resistant housing at speed | Affordable housing · Disaster recovery · Workforce housing | Housing supply · Community rebuilding · Economic development |
